Exploring the Mechanics of Automatic Cleaning

At their core, automatic hoovers are created to browse your home autonomously and clean floorings without direct human control. They attain this through a combination of sophisticated technologies, consisting of sensing units, navigation systems, and cleaning systems.

The majority of automatic hoovers run on rechargeable batteries and come with a charging dock. When their battery is low, or after finishing a cleaning cycle, they instantly return to their dock to charge. The cleaning procedure itself usually includes:

  • Navigation: This is arguably the most important aspect. Automatic hoovers utilize different navigation methods to map and traverse your home. Early designs frequently used bump-and-go navigation, randomly bouncing around till they covered an area. Nevertheless, modern-day designs use advanced systems like:

    • SLAM (Simultaneous Localization and Mapping): This technology permits the robot to construct a map of its surroundings in real-time while all at once determining its place within that map.
    • LiDAR (Light Detection and Ranging): LiDAR utilizes laser beams to measure distances and develop highly precise maps, allowing efficient and organized cleaning patterns.
    • VSLAM (Visual Simultaneous Localization and Mapping): Similar to SLAM but counts on electronic cameras instead of lasers to view and map the environment.
    • Gyroscope and Odometry: Some designs integrate gyroscopes and wheel sensors (odometry) to track movement and direction, improving navigation.
  • Sensing units: A myriad of sensors are integrated to help the robot hoover communicate securely and efficiently with its environment. These commonly include:

    • Cliff sensors: Prevent the robot from dropping stairs or ledges.
    • Barrier sensors: Detect challenges like furnishings, walls, and pet bowls, allowing the robot to navigate around them.
    • Wall sensing units: Enable the robot to follow walls and edges for extensive edge cleaning.
    • Dirt detection sensors: In some advanced designs, these sensors can identify locations with higher concentrations of dirt and debris, prompting more focused cleaning.
  • Cleaning Mechanisms: Automatic hoovers normally employ a mix of:

    • Rotating brushes: These brushes sweep dirt and particles from the floor towards the suction inlet. They often are available in different styles for different floor types.
    • Side brushes: Extend the cleaning reach to edges and corners.
    • Suction: Generates airflow to raise dirt and dust into the dustbin. Suction power varies between models.
    • Mopping pads: Some hybrid models integrate mopping functionality, utilizing moist pads to carefully mop difficult floorings after or during vacuuming.

Kinds Of Automatic Hoovers: From Basic to Feature-Rich

The marketplace for automatic hoovers is varied, catering to a vast array of needs and budgets. They can be broadly classified based on their features and performances:

  • Basic Models: These are usually entry-level robots concentrating on fundamental cleaning. They frequently utilize bump-and-go navigation or easier gyroscope-based navigation. They are normally more inexpensive however might do not have sophisticated features like mapping, app control, or strong suction.

  • Mid-Range Models: Offering a balance in between rate and features, these models frequently incorporate smart navigation (SLAM, LiDAR, or VSLAM), app connection, and scheduling capabilities. They generally supply more effective cleaning patterns and much better barrier avoidance than fundamental models.

  • High-End Models: These are the exceptional offerings, loaded with innovative innovations and functions. They often boast exceptional navigation, mapping capabilities, multi-floor mapping (remembering maps for different levels of your home), personalized cleaning zones, "no-go" zones (areas you want to prevent cleaning), self-emptying dustbins, and combination with smart home environments.

  • Hybrid Vacuum-Mop Models: These flexible robots combine vacuuming and mopping functionalities in one gadget. They can vacuum up dry debris and after that mop hard floors with a damp pad, offering a two-in-one cleaning service.

  • Specialized Models: Certain automatic hoovers are designed with particular needs in mind, such as designs optimized for pet hair elimination with effective suction and tangle-free brushes, or models developed for homes with carpets, including carpet increase innovation to increase suction power on carpeted surfaces.

The Benefits of Embracing Automatic Cleaning

The appeal of automatic hoovers comes from the many advantages they offer:

  • Convenience and Time-Saving: The most considerable advantage is unquestionably the hands-free cleaning experience. You can set them to clean while you are at work, running errands, or merely relaxing, maximizing important time.
  • Constant Cleaning: Automatic hoovers can be arranged to clean regularly, making sure constant floor tidiness and decreasing the accumulation of dust and irritants.
  • Availability: For senior people or those with movement concerns, automatic hoovers can provide a vital help in keeping a clean home without physical strain.
  • Pet Hair Management: Automatic hoovers, specifically designs designed for pet owners, work at capturing pet hair, dander, and allergens, contributing to a much healthier home environment.
  • Improved Air Quality: By regularly getting rid of dust and irritants, automatic hoovers can contribute to better indoor air quality, especially useful for people with allergic reactions or breathing level of sensitivities.
  • Reaching Under Furniture: Their low profile permits them to clean up under beds, sofas, and other furnishings where standard vacuums often have a hard time to reach.

Choosing the Right Automatic Hoover for Your Home

Choosing the ideal automatic hoover depends on individual requirements and home qualities. Think about these aspects when making your choice:

  • Floor Types: Determine the main floor types in your home (hardwood, carpet, tile, and so on). Some models are much better fit for specific floor types. Check if the model is designed for carpets if you have significant carpeted locations.
  • Home Size and Layout: Larger homes might benefit from designs with longer battery life and advanced mapping capabilities for effective cleaning. Complex designs with multiple rooms and barriers might require robotics with superior navigation.
  • Budget plan: Automatic hoovers vary significantly in cost. Establish a spending plan and check out models within your cost range that offer the features you need.
  • Features: Prioritize features based on your needs. Consider:
    • Navigation System: SLAM, LiDAR, VSLAM for effective and systematic cleaning.
    • App Control and Smart Features: Scheduling, zone cleaning, no-go zones, smart home integration.
    • Suction Power: Higher suction for pet hair and carpets.
    • Battery Life: Longer run time for bigger homes.
    • self cleaning robot vacuum-Emptying Dustbin: For included benefit and less frequent maintenance.
    • Mopping Functionality: If you desire to mop tough floors as well.
    • Sound Level: Consider models with lower sound levels if noise level of sensitivity is a concern.

Preserving Your Automatic Hoover

To ensure optimum efficiency and longevity, routine maintenance is important:

  • Empty the Dustbin Regularly: Frequent clearing avoids the dustbin from overfilling and preserves suction performance. Self-emptying models lower this job considerably.
  • Tidy Brushes and Filters: Hair and particles can accumulate on brushes and filters, minimizing cleaning effectiveness. Clean them regularly according to the maker's guidelines.
  • Inspect Sensors: Ensure sensors are tidy and totally free from dust or obstructions for correct navigation.
  • Change Parts as Needed: Brushes and filters will ultimately need replacement. Follow the maker's suggestions for replacement periods.
  • Battery Care: While usually long-lasting, batteries have a lifespan. Follow charging directions and prevent leaving the robot continuously on the charger when completely charged to make the most of battery health.

Frequently Asked Questions (FAQs) about Automatic Hoovers

Q1: Are automatic hoovers as effective as conventional vacuum cleaners?A: While suction power has actually considerably enhanced in recent models, most automatic hoovers might not match the deep cleaning power of a high-end standard upright or canister vacuum, specifically for greatly stained areas or thick carpets. However, for daily cleaning and upkeep, they are usually extremely effective.

Q2: Can automatic hoovers clean all kinds of floorings?A: Many automatic hoovers are created to work well on different floor types, consisting of wood, tile, laminate, and low-pile carpets. Nevertheless, some models are much better matched for specific floor types. Inspect product specifications to make sure compatibility with your floor covering.

Q3: How long do automatic hoover batteries last?A: Battery life varies depending upon the design and cleaning mode. Many models provide between 60 to 120 minutes of run time on a single charge. Higher-end designs may offer even longer battery life.

Q4: Are automatic hoovers noisy?A: Noise levels differ among models. Normally, they are quieter than traditional auto vacuum cleaner cleaners, but some noise is still created. Consider models with lower decibel ratings if noise level of sensitivity is a concern.

Q5: Do automatic hoovers need a great deal of upkeep?A: Routine upkeep is essential, consisting of emptying the dustbin, cleaning brushes and filters, and sometimes examining sensing units. Self-emptying models reduce the frequency of dustbin emptying.

Q6: Can automatic hoovers manage pet hair efficiently?A: Yes, numerous automatic hoovers are particularly designed for pet owners and are extremely reliable at picking up pet hair. Look for models with functions like tangle-free brushes and strong suction, typically marketed as "pet hair" models.

Q7: What takes place if an automatic hoover gets stuck?A: Modern automatic hoovers are geared up with barrier sensors and navigation systems to reduce getting stuck. Nevertheless, they might occasionally get stuck on cords, loose carpets, or in tight areas. The majority of models will stop and signal if they are stuck, frequently by means of an app alert.

Q8: Can I manage an automatic hoover remotely?A: Many mid-range and high-end designs include mobile phone app connectivity, enabling push-button control, scheduling, keeping an eye on cleaning status, and accessing features like zone cleaning and no-go zones.
